The Team
The Audit Professional Practices Group (PPG) is dedicated to maintaining Fidelity’s audit methodology in accordance with IIA standards and industry-leading approaches. We are committed to delivering high-quality assistance and supporting our auditors with the best tools and resources available. The PPG coordinates the annual risk assessment, executive and committee reporting, business intelligence and audit insights, workforce management reporting, records retention compliance, and systems access. We strive to ensure that our practices not only meet but exceed required standards, contributing to Fidelity’s reputation for excellence.
